Strikes all round at the start of this round, plenty of bowlers startiing with doubles. McLoughlin and Sloan match each other frame-for-frame with four strikes to open with.
Shane Hendrick also goes front four, with his opponent Ryan Press keeping in touching disatnce with doubles either side of a nine-spare.
Dave English starting confidently in game one. He sits on 115 for six frames working on a double.
Dave Noonan inconsistent in his first game with Aimee Kellegher. Kellegher playing solidly to hold a 35 pin lead through seven frames.
Nick King and Carl McDermott are contesting a close match in game through game one. Darragh McLoughlin holds an 11 pin lead over Chris Sloan coming to the end of game one.
Barry Foley is struggling again in game one here. He trails by 50 pins through seven frames.
McLoughlin takes a 20 pin lead into game two. Hendrick holds 30 pin lead over Press.
Greg Gardiner trails Amanda Larkin by 50 pins in the final frame of game one.
Dave English trails Maria O'Toole by 50 pins in the early stages of game two.
Enzo Palluci leads Eamon Ward by 100 pins half way through game two of their match.
Maria O'Toole turkey's to widen her lead over Dave English to 80 pins. Hendrick still leads Press, while McLoughlin continues to keep Sloan at bay with a double.
Barry Foley finally looks to have found some form in game two. However, his opponent Andrew Swale continues to carry well and maintains his healthy lead.
McLoughlin holds 50 pin lead going into the final game against Sloan.
Kellegher leads Noonan by 80 pins in the early stages of game three. English trails O'Toole by 110 pins. Foley closes the gap on Smale to 25 pins.
Press bowls 270 to take over the lead against Hendrick going into game three.
Foley goes front four in game three to take the lead against Smale.
English putting up a fight against O'Toole, pacing 259 in the final game. He trails by 70 though and it looks like being too much to get back.
Last year's runner up Noonan is out of this year's tournament, losing to Aimee Kellegher.
Foley opens and throws ball into the ditch to give Smale a chance. Foley splits in the tenth to open the door and allow Smale to close out the match, which he does. Smale through to the next round, but the defending champion goes out early.
McLoughlin is a 50 pin winner over Chris Sloan and advances to round three. Press takes out Hendrick to advance to the next round.
Amanda Larkin also into round three after a comfortable victory over Greg Gardiner.
